Aberdeen Minerals Secures £294,000 in Grant Funding by the UK Government
The motion
That the Parliament congratulates Aberdeen Minerals on securing £294,000 in grant funding by the UK Government; understands that the funding was achieved through the Automotive Transformation Fund (ATF), which will meet 70% of the cost of a feasibility study into innovative methods to process minerals at the company’s Arthrath Nickel-Copper-Cobalt Project in Aberdeenshire; further understands that the study will investigate the potential to accelerate the production of cathode raw materials in north-east Scotland for UK battery manufacturing, using more environmentally sustainable and socially acceptable approaches; notes that the ATF is delivered by the Advanced Propulsion Centre in collaboration with the UK Department for Business and Trade and Innovate UK, and wishes continued success for Aberdeen Minerals in the future.
